SHAH ALAM: Tan Sri Abdul Khalid Ibrahim said Saturday his decision to stand for the post of Parti Keadilan Rakyat (PKR) deputy president at the party elections in May was made based on pleas by party colleagues.
The Selangor menteri besar said PKR de facto leader Datuk Seri Anwar Ibrahim had also complimented him as a good administrator and party leader.
